#e47596 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e47596 is composed of 89.4% red, 45.9% green and 58.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 48.7% magenta, 34.2% yellow and 10.6% black. It has a hue angle of 342.2 degrees, a saturation of 67.3% and a lightness of 67.6%. #e47596 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ffeaff with #c9002d. Closest websafe color is: #cc6699.

#e47596 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#e47596 has RGB values of R:228, G:117, B:150 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.49, Y:0.34, K:0.11. Its decimal value is 14972310.

Hex triplet e47596 #e47596
RGB Decimal 228, 117, 150 rgb(228,117,150)
RGB Percent 89.4, 45.9, 58.8 rgb(89.4%,45.9%,58.8%)
CMYK 0, 49, 34, 11
HSL 342.2°, 67.3, 67.6 hsl(342.2,67.3%,67.6%)
HSV (or HSB) 342.2°, 48.7, 89.4
Web Safe cc6699 #cc6699
CIE-LAB 62.862, 46.461, 2.161
XYZ 43.862, 31.422, 32.607
xyY 0.407, 0.291, 31.422
CIE-LCH 62.862, 46.511, 2.663
CIE-LUV 62.862, 72.212, -5.731
Hunter-Lab 56.055, 41.575, 4.749
Binary 11100100, 01110101, 10010110
